SAN DIEGO (FOX 5/KUSI) -- A popular San Diego pier is reopening starting next week. On Monday, Crystal Pier in Pacific Beach will fully reopen after closing for 18 months following storm damage in December 2023. From January 2024 to March 2025, the pier underwent two emergency construction phases, replacing dozens of damaged or broken braces supporting the wooden structure. SAN DIEGO – The Crystal pier in Pacific Beach will reopen on Monday, the city of San Diego announced on Thursday. The structure, almost 100 years old, was damaged by several storms, which caused the closure of the public part of the pier in December 2023. The city says that the main repairs have been completed and that the pier has been considered structurally safe.
